Transaction 917f26a886c0969b15b3f428939eb53e36ef099b07e52d528afb73540ae3f914

1 Input
2 Outputs
  • 917f26a886c0969b15b3f428939eb53e36ef099b07e52d528afb73540ae3f914:0
  • value  45187931
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
  • 917f26a886c0969b15b3f428939eb53e36ef099b07e52d528afb73540ae3f914:1
  • value  436657561
    address  3AoWhzrDWsSDk3LKW2qioCxRt5HYNHjM98